Central Market - Kuala Lumpur

    • Central Market, a former wet market, has been lovingly and cleverly preserved, restored and transformed into a one-stop cultural shopping complex. This 123-year old structure, with a glorious Art Deco exterior, is home to dozens of kiosks and stores brimming with local handicraft, home wares, antiques, fashion, jewelry and quirky souvenirs. Different zones are used to categorize the different cultures – the Malay lane is where you can find all things Malay from wau (kites), songket (silk), keris (Malay dagger) and batik; Chinese and Indian lanes. Amble past traders and fortune-tellers, all of whom can be seen busy plying their wares. Good investments include silver, wau, songket, batik, pewter, wood craft, Chinese painting, and Nyonya Baba antiques. Sometimes prices can be slightly elevated than what you may find elsewhere. These days you can find products from all over Asia at the Central Market.
